What is ファイバードラム?
In this glossary, ファイバードラム refers to: A cylindrical container made of fiberboard, used for packing solid or powdered substances, including certain dangerous goods per UN packaging codes.
How is ファイバードラム used in logistics?
In logistics communication, this term appears in contexts such as: "ファイバードラム包装が認められている固体化学品は、UN1G基準に適合したドラムに詰めなければなりません。"
